Knockout Round
January 28th - January 30th, 2022
8 Nations, 7th Place Match, 5th Place Match, Semifinals, Bronze Medal Match and Gold Medal Match, the winning Nation will be the Men's Handball AHF Asian Championship 2022 Champion

15th Place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)

Australia AUS.gif 21 - 25 IND.gif India
Half-Time: 14-11
January 28th 2022, h. 16:00, Prince Nayef Sports City Hall, Qatif

 

 

13th Place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)

Singapore SGP.gif 20 - 33 VIE.gif Vietnam
Half-Time: 11-15
January 28th 2022, h. 18:00, Prince Nayef Sports City Hall, Qatif


 
11th Place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)
 
Hong Kong HKG.gif 27 - 26 JOR.gif Jordan
Half-Time: 11-15
January 28th 2022, h. 16: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am


 
9th Place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)
 
Oman OMA.gif 24 - 27 UAE.gif United Arab Emirates
Half-Time: 10-11
January 28th 2022, h. 18: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am

 

 

 

Semifinals
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)
 
Qatar QAT.gif 34 - 19 IRI.gif Iran
Half-Time: 20-10
January 29th 2022, h. 16: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am
I
Bahrain BRN.gif 29 - 20 KSA.gif Saudi Arabia
Half-Time: 16-9
January 29th 2022, h. 18: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am

 

 

7th Place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)
 
Uzbekistan UZB.gif 30 - 32 KUW.gif Kuwait
Half-Time: 16-17
January 30th 2022, h. 16:00,
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am


 
5th Place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)

South Korea KOR.gif 26 - 24 IRQ.gifIraq
Half-Time: 13-11
January 30th 2022, h. 18: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am

 

 

Bronze Medal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)
 
Iran IRI.gif 23 - 26 KSA.gif Saudi Arabia
Half-Time: 12-15
January 31st 2022, h. 16: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am

 

 

Gold Medal Match
Arabia Standard Time (GMT +3)
 
Qatar QAT.gif  29 - 24 BRN.gif Bahrain
Half-Time: 14-11
January 31st 2022, h. 18:00, Ministry of Sports Hall, Dammam
